What companies run services between Rotterdam, Netherlands and Suffolk, England?
You can take a train from Rotterdam Centraal to Stowmarket via London St. Pancras Int., King's Cross St. Pancras station, Liverpool Street station, and London Liverpool Street in around 5h 27m. Alternatively, Stena Line operates a ferry from Port of Hoek van Holland to Harwich International Port twice daily. Tickets cost £55–90 and the journey takes 7h.
